If you have decided that consulting with an orthodontist is better than going to a regular dentist, then the next step is to look for the orthodontist who is right for you. There are two kinds of orthodontists: regular orthodontists and board-certified orthodontists. If you should choose between these two, always go for the board certified experts.

Aside from the education and training that regular orthodontists go through, the board certified experts offer improved and complete oral care. This is due to the fact that they are mandated to renew their certification every ten years so as to keep their certification.

To be a board-certified orthodontist, one must be a member of the American Board of Orthodontics. They have to follow the accreditation guidelines of the organization and abide by their every rule to ensure their membership status. Renewing one’s certification is also necessary, which may also suggest they need to go through continual training.

Dental Impression – is the procedure by which a putty-like clay compound is deposited in a device called a tray. The tray is then placed in your mouth, and once you bite down on it, a negative imprint of your dental arch is created. From this imprint, a positive reproduction can be cast. Dental impressions are used throughout the dental industry quite frequently. Their most common application includes the creation of mouth guards, whitening trays, retainers, crowns, bridges, veneers, dentures, and dental models, among other things. Although better technology now exists, many dentists insist on using them because they are cheap and easy to use, even if they don’t provide the best patient experience.
